Great Cycle Challenge is a month-long cycling challenge that raises funds to fight kids’ cancers. Funds raised go to the SickKids Foundation. The goal is to fund life-saving research to develop safer and more effective treatments, and find cures for all childhood cancers.
Why? Because cancer is the largest killer of kids in Canada; 27 children are diagnosed every week.
